Description
The importance of an integrated approach in urban design is becoming increasingly apparent. This book explains how to overcome related challenges in the environmental design of urban buildings, offering guidance on the use of new materials and techniques and on the integration of new philosophies.
International experts in the field explore the relationship of building design to the urban setting. Designed as an academic module that can satisfy postgraduate certificate requirements and is suitable for distance learning, this book includes a free CD-ROM, containing multi-media tools, a library of suppliers and climate data.
